Beschrijving voorzijde The obverse is enclosed within a decorative border with guilloche elements; a central vignette presents a view of the city of Cahors flanked on each side by representations of a 50-centime Semeuse coin bearing a double date. The heading reads CHAMBRE DE COMMERCE DE CAHORS, with the denomination UN FRANC and republican motto LIBERTÉ - ÉGALITÉ - FRATERNITÉ inscribed within the design. Signature panels for the Treasurer and President appear at the lower portion, alongside the departmental designation LOT.

Opmerkingen

Cahors issued its own fractional emergency notes during the coin shortage that gripped France throughout the First World War — a shortage so acute that hundreds of individual Chambres de Commerce across the country were authorized to produce their own low-denomination paper. The Limoges firm of Pierre Dumont handled a significant share of this regional work, and their output for Lot department issuers is well documented.

The JP#35-22/24 sequence covers three distinct dated varieties within the 1917–1919 window. Collectors should note that the watermark security feature — modest by any standard — was the primary distinguishing element separating these notes from outright forgeries, of which provincial wartime issues attracted more than a few.
